Environmental Heroes (KS1 & KS2)

Copy of Environmental Heroes 1900.jpg

How can we respect, protect and enjoy our environment?

This interactive session is based around the three main principles of the countryside code: respect, protect and enjoy. We will learn how to achieve all of these principles when visiting our local parks, and how we can each make a positive impact on the environment. 

 

How does this session link to the National Curriculum? (Key Stage 1 & 2)
  • What improves and harms their local, natural and built environments and about some of the ways people look after them.
  • To realise that people and other living things have needs, and that they have responsibilities to meet them.
  • Meet and talk with people (for example, with outside visitors such as religious leaders, police officers, the school nurse).
  • Why and how rules and laws are made and enforced, why different rules are needed in different situations and how to take part in making and changing rules.
  • Taking responsibility.
  • Identify and name a variety of everyday materials, including wood, plastic, glass, metal, water, and rock.
